What Makes Olive Oil the Best Choice for Oil Lamps?

Olive oil is often regarded as the best choice for oil lamps due to several beneficial properties.

  • High Smoke Point: Olive oil has a relatively high smoke point, which means it can burn steadily without producing excessive smoke or soot.
  • Natural Composition: The natural composition of olive oil allows for a clean burn, reducing harmful emissions that can be found in other oils.
  • Aroma and Flavor: Olive oil gives off a pleasant aroma when burned, enhancing the ambiance and making it suitable for indoor use.
  • Long Shelf Life: Olive oil can last for a long time without going rancid, making it a convenient choice for oil lamps that may not be used frequently.
  • Availability and Versatility: Olive oil is widely available and can be used for both culinary purposes and as fuel for lamps, providing versatility in its usage.

The high smoke point of olive oil ensures that the flame burns consistently while minimizing unpleasant smoke, making it ideal for creating a cozy atmosphere.

Its natural composition, rich in monounsaturated fats and antioxidants, helps produce a cleaner burn compared to many synthetic oils, contributing to better air quality in enclosed spaces.

The pleasant aroma released during combustion not only adds to the sensory experience but also makes it a more appealing option for use in homes and gatherings.

With a long shelf life, olive oil remains suitable for lamp use over time, allowing users to keep it on hand without the concern of spoilage.

Finally, the availability of olive oil in various qualities and grades means that users can choose the best olive oil for lamp use based on their preferences and budget, making it a practical option as well.

What Are the Different Types of Olive Oil Suitable for Lamp Use?

The different types of olive oil suitable for lamp use include:

  • Extra Virgin Olive Oil: This is the highest quality olive oil, extracted from olives using cold-press methods without any chemical treatments.
  • Virgin Olive Oil: Virgin olive oil is also made from cold-pressed olives but has a slightly higher level of acidity compared to extra virgin olive oil, making it less flavorful but still suitable for lamps.
  • Pure Olive Oil: This type consists of a blend of refined olive oil and a small amount of virgin olive oil, offering a more neutral flavor and higher smoke point, which can be advantageous for lamp use.
  • Olive Oil Blend: These oils are mixed with other oils, which can alter the burning properties and cost-effectiveness, but they may not provide the same quality of burn as pure olive oils.
  • Refined Olive Oil: This oil undergoes processing to neutralize flavors and remove impurities, resulting in a clear oil that burns well in lamps but may lack the robust characteristics of unrefined oils.

Extra virgin olive oil is prized for its rich flavor and aroma, making it a popular choice for decorative lamps that enhance ambiance. Its low acidity and high antioxidant content also contribute to a cleaner burn, making it less likely to produce soot.

Virgin olive oil, while slightly less premium, still retains a good quality for lamp use, offering a balance between flavor and functionality. Its higher acidity might affect the burn quality slightly, but it remains a viable option for those seeking a more economical choice.

Pure olive oil combines refined and virgin oils, which helps in creating a more stable and consistent burn. This type is often recommended for lamp use since it has a higher smoke point, reducing the likelihood of smoke production.

Olive oil blends can be cost-effective but may not perform as well as pure olive oils in terms of burn quality. The additional oils included can affect the burning characteristics, so users should be mindful of the specific blend they choose.

Refined olive oil is well-suited for lamp use due to its clarity and neutral scent, making it ideal for those who prefer a less aromatic option. However, its processing means it may not provide the same depth of flavor or health benefits associated with unrefined oils.

What Alternatives Are There to Olive Oil for Burning in Lamps?

There are several alternatives to olive oil that can be used for burning in lamps:

  • Coconut Oil: Coconut oil is a great alternative due to its high saturated fat content, which allows it to burn slowly and efficiently. It has a pleasant aroma and can produce a bright flame, making it suitable for use in lamps.
  • Canola Oil: Canola oil is commonly used in household lamps because it is widely available and affordable. It has a relatively high smoke point and burns cleanly, producing minimal soot, which is beneficial for maintaining the lamp’s condition.
  • Vegetable Oil: Generic vegetable oil, which is typically a blend of various oils, is another viable option for lamp fuel. It burns well and is cost-effective, but it may produce more soot compared to other oils, so regular maintenance of the lamp is necessary.
  • Peanut Oil: Peanut oil has a high smoking point and burns brightly, making it a good choice for lamps. It also provides a longer burn time, but its distinct nutty aroma may not be suitable for every setting.
  • Sunflower Oil: Sunflower oil is another alternative that burns cleanly and has a relatively neutral scent. It is a popular choice for those looking to achieve a bright flame while maintaining a pleasant atmosphere.
  • Sesame Oil: Sesame oil is less common but can be used in lamps due to its high smoke point and long burn time. Its unique fragrance can add a lovely aroma to the environment, although not everyone may prefer the scent.
